Stage 16 success for Rasmussen

Yellow jersey holder Michael Rasmussen brought a thrilling end to a controversial day in the Tour de France by winning stage 16 from Orthez to Col d’Aubisque.

The Rabobank rider claimed glory on the demanding Pyrenees mountain-top finish, widely regarded as the toughest stage of this year’s Tour, 26 seconds ahead of fellow yellow jersey contender Levi Leipheimer and 35 seconds clear of Alberto Contador as they fought out a gruelling three-way battle for stage success.
